Interesting Facts About Kangaroos
- They can’t walk backward – Due to their powerful hind legs and long tail, kangaroos are unable to move in reverse.
- They use their tail like a third leg – A kangaroo’s strong tail helps with balance and even supports their weight while walking.
- Baby kangaroos are called joeys – When born, a joey is about the size of a jellybean and grows inside its mother’s pouch.
- They are amazing jumpers – Kangaroos can leap over 25 feet in a single bound and travel at speeds up to 35 mph.
- They only live in Australia – Kangaroos are native to Australia and are considered one of the country’s most iconic animals.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
What do kangaroos eat?
Kangaroos are herbivores—they mostly eat grass, leaves, and shrubs. They need a lot of fiber and can even regurgitate food to chew it again like cows!
How fast can kangaroos hop?
Kangaroos can hop at speeds up to 35 miles (56 km) per hour for short bursts and comfortably cruise at around 15 mph. Their strong legs make them built for speed and distance!
How long do baby kangaroos stay in the pouch?
A joey stays in its mother’s pouch for about 6 to 8 months and continues to nurse and return to safety for a few more months after that.
Do kangaroos live in groups?
Yes! Kangaroos live in social groups called “mobs,” which usually include 10 to 50 members led by a dominant male.
Are kangaroos only found in Australia?
Mostly, yes. Kangaroos are native to Australia, though some species can also be found in parts of Papua New Guinea.
